Highest Japanese population share, Maine counties · 2020

Maine counties ranked by the share of all residents who are Japanese (2020 American Community Survey). A concentration measure: Japanese residents as a percentage of total population. This list covers the 15 counties in Maine that qualify, ranked against each other statewide.
